Subject: Quickstore 4.2 — bloom filter now fronts the KV layer

Plugin authors: starting with this release, Quickstore places a bloom filter ahead of the key-value store. Negative lookups return faster; false positives fall through safely. No API changes are required on your side. Verify your plugin against the staging build referenced below.

session token of fahif-tadup = htk3_9c7

**Action Item PM-14 (DeployDove outage):** The chat bot silently dropped deploy-status polls when the queue backed off. Since you're new to Marbleworks infra, please read the retry wrapper in `dovecote/poller.py` before changing anything. We agreed to pin the backoff and poll-interval values explicitly rather than inheriting defaults. The agreed tuning constants are listed below.

tuning table, hafog-bahaf:
QUOTAS = {
    "praion": 144,
    "briax": 906,
    "silwyn": 451,
}

**14:22 — Leak confirmed in Tidewren image cache**

Ok, so this is where it got fun: eviction callbacks on the Tidewren thumbnail cache were never firing, so decoded bitmaps just piled up until the renderer tipped over. Heap dumps made it obvious once we looked. First bad build is stamped below.

session token of bagep-haduf = htk4_fac0

- [ ] Step 7: Archive cold storage buckets (Glacierline tier). Confirm both ceremony witnesses are present, verify bucket manifests match the Oxbow ledger, then seal the archive key shares. Plugin authors may observe but not handle shares. Once sealed, the archive index itself is encrypted and can only be reopened with the passphrase below.

vault phrase of badup-hahig = tamael-aldael-kelmir-istael-fenok-istwyn-tamius-jorath-oliion